Transaction 536ae7587801260d39281746b12a19bad9a1ba9e426a896fca2f34603d68f2b1

34 Input
2 Outputs
  • 536ae7587801260d39281746b12a19bad9a1ba9e426a896fca2f34603d68f2b1:0
  • value  36800000
    address  3C8L7vsADABKVe7AG7aB6RD3dyRgVbkEma
  • 536ae7587801260d39281746b12a19bad9a1ba9e426a896fca2f34603d68f2b1:1
  • value  1007576
    address  33NBAAPQGcK143RM8yya3FnJ5kjmqdyVMH